Commercial Description:
Bottle: Pasteurised.
Marketed in the United States as Olde Suffolk.
A blend of two ales: Old 5X , which is brewed to the maximum strength possible (around 12% abv) and left to mature in 100-barrel oak vats for a minimum of two years, and BPA, a dark, full-bodied freshly brewed beer which is added just before bottling. The result is a unique beer - strong (6% abv), dark, fruity, oaky and very, very special.

Brown cola colored beer with small beige head. Wonderful aroma of port and fruit with a touch of allspice. Rich, mouth filling flavors, the port again, oak barrel, tannins, honey, wildflower hops. Nice feel and good bitter finish. Quite a nice find! Definitely one I will seek out again!

This is a cool beer to pour. The foam mixes with the body to make for a creamy appearance. The aroma is malty and dark fruit. Mouth feel is smooth as silk and feels great. Flavor is complex featuring malt, alcohol, wood, dark fruit, bitterness, caramel and some sherry. What a nice beer!

500 ml bottle - pours a rich mahogany with red highlights. Aroma of vanilla, very sweet malt, some light English hopping, plums and toffee. Flavour is a little bit of a letdown after this very nice aroma - more muted, with a strange bitterness and an almost astringent quality. Fairly thin in the mouth and a very short finish. Good, certainly, but a touch overrated, perhaps.
